libfilezilla
socket_interface Member List

This is the complete list of members for socket_interface, including all inherited members.

connect(native_string const &host, unsigned int port, address_type family=address_type::unknown)=0 (defined in socket_interface)socket_interfacepure virtual
get_state() const =0 (defined in socket_interface)socket_interfacepure virtual
operator=(socket_interface const &)=delete (defined in socket_interface)socket_interface
peer_host() const =0 (defined in socket_interface)socket_interfacepure virtual
peer_port(int &error) const =0 (defined in socket_interface)socket_interfacepure virtual
read(void *buffer, unsigned int size, int &error)=0 (defined in socket_interface)socket_interfacepure virtual
read(void *buffer, T size, int &error) (defined in socket_interface)socket_interfaceinline
read(void *buffer, T size, int &error) (defined in socket_interface)socket_interfaceinline
root() constsocket_event_sourceinline
root_ (defined in socket_event_source)socket_event_sourceprotected
set_event_handler(event_handler *pEvtHandler, fz::socket_event_flag retrigger_block=fz::socket_event_flag{})=0 (defined in socket_interface)socket_interfacepure virtual
shutdown()=0socket_interfacepure virtual
shutdown_read()=0socket_interfacepure virtual
socket_event_source()=delete (defined in socket_event_source)socket_event_sourceprotected
socket_event_source(socket_event_source *root) (defined in socket_event_source)socket_event_sourceinlineexplicitprotected
socket_interface(socket_interface const &)=delete (defined in socket_interface)socket_interface
socket_interface()=delete (defined in socket_interface)socket_interfaceprotected
socket_interface(socket_event_source *root) (defined in socket_interface)socket_interfaceinlineexplicitprotected
write(void const *buffer, unsigned int size, int &error)=0 (defined in socket_interface)socket_interfacepure virtual
write(void const *buffer, T size, int &error) (defined in socket_interface)socket_interfaceinline
write(void const *buffer, T size, int &error) (defined in socket_interface)socket_interfaceinline
~socket_event_source()=default (defined in socket_event_source)socket_event_sourcevirtual